Why is Wattage Important for Travel Hair Dryers?
Wattage is important for travel hair dryers because it dictates their drying power and efficiency. Higher wattage typically means more heat and faster drying time, which is especially useful when traveling and needing quick results.
According to the U.S. Department of Energy, wattage is a measure of electrical power expressed in watts (W). It indicates how much energy an appliance uses. In the context of hair dryers, higher wattage correlates with greater airflow and temperature settings, allowing for effective styling.
The main reasons wattage matters include drying speed, heat output, and compatibility with power sources. Higher wattage hair dryers can often dry hair in less time, saving users from extended grooming sessions. They also produce hotter air, which can be more effective in straightening or curling hair quickly. Additionally, travelers must consider the electrical outlets available in different countries, as some may not support high-wattage appliances.
In technical terms, the heating element within the hair dryer converts electrical energy into heat energy. This process is influenced by wattage. A dryer with a wattage between 1200 to 1800 watts is generally effective for most hair types. Low-wattage dryers may be less efficient, leading to longer drying times.
Specific conditions that affect hair drying efficiency include humidity levels and hair type. For example, thick or curly hair may require a high-wattage dryer for efficient drying. In a humid environment, even a high-wattage dryer may struggle, but it will still perform better than one with lower wattage. Travelers should also consider voltage regulations. Some countries use 220-240 volts, while others use 110-120 volts, which can impact the performance of high-wattage dryers.

Compatibility with different voltage standards: Dual voltage refers to appliances that can operate on both 110-120V and 220-240V systems, which are common in different regions of the world. For example, North America often uses 110-120V, while most of Europe uses 220-240V. According to the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C), this compatibility reduces the likelihood of needing multiple devices for different regions.
-
Portability for international travelers: Dual voltage devices are particularly advantageous for travelers. A dual voltage hair dryer, for instance, can be used in various countries without the need for a voltage converter. Travelers can easily switch settings between voltages, simplifying their journey. Risk of damage to devices without dual voltage capability: Devices not rated for dual voltage risk destruction when plugged into incompatible systems. If a 110V appliance is mistakenly plugged into a 240V outlet, it can overheat and become damaged. This risk underscores the importance of dual voltage appliances, as noted in a consumer safety report by Consumer Product Safety Commission (2022).
-
Confusion around voltage and frequency differences: There is often confusion about not just voltage differences but also the frequency of electricity supply, which can vary from 50Hz to 60Hz. This can affect the performance of certain appliances, such as clocks and timers. -
Concentrator Nozzle: A concentrator nozzle is an essential attachment that focuses airflow. It helps in directing heat precisely to sections of hair. This attachment is useful for achieving sleek styles and precise blowouts. Many users appreciate its ability to reduce frizz and enhance shine.
-
Diffuser: A diffuser is designed to disperse airflow evenly. It is ideal for curly or wavy hair as it reduces heat exposure and maintains the natural curl pattern. This attachment is popular among those with textured hair. It promotes volume and lessens frizz during the drying process.
-
Comb Attachment: A comb attachment can detangle hair while drying. It helps in straightening hair by combining heat with tension. Users with thick or unruly hair might find this feature beneficial for achieving smooth results.
-
Heat-Resistant Travel Pouch: A heat-resistant travel pouch protects other items in luggage from hot tools. It is a practical accessory that ensures safety while packing. Travelers appreciate the added convenience of storing a hot hair dryer safely.
-
Dual Voltage Feature: The dual voltage feature enables compatibility with international power outlets. It allows travelers to use the hair dryer in multiple countries without a voltage converter. This feature is essential for frequent travelers to avoid damage to devices.
How Can You Extend the Life of Your Travel Hair Dryer?
To extend the life of your travel hair dryer, follow proper care practices, avoid overuse, and store it safely when not in use.
Proper care is essential to maintain the functionality of a travel hair dryer. Regularly clean the filter. Dust and lint can accumulate in the filter and restrict airflow. Cleaning the filter enhances efficiency and prevents overheating. Unplug the dryer after use. Leaving it plugged in can lead to wear on the cord and internal components. Ensure you store it in a cool, dry place. High humidity can lead to electrical faults. Avoid wrapping the cord tightly around the device. This can cause damage to the cord over time. Instead, loosely coil it to prevent stress on the wiring.
Avoiding overuse helps preserve the dryer’s lifespan. Limit the number of consecutive uses. Regarding heat settings, using a lower heat setting can reduce damage. High heat can deteriorate the internal components faster. Calculate the usage time. Experts recommend giving the dryer breaks after every 15-20 minutes of use to cool off.
Safe storage is equally important for longevity. Use a protective bag or pouch during travel. This can prevent scratches and other physical damage. Ensure the dryer is completely cool before storing. Storing it while hot can warp its internal parts. Avoid placing heavy items on top of it in your luggage. This can cause dents and damage the housing.
Implementing these practices can significantly enhance the lifespan of your travel hair dryer.
